Output 3ac3f4fcb556459462a781b902cea23dcc29afa7ef6a94cc6a9a3b53aba6dbd6:0

value
1373864
script pubkey
OP_0 OP_PUSHBYTES_20 89676860bcc65bf054560ab898126d7ac6994178
address
bc1q39nksc9ucedlq4zkp2ufsynd0trfjstcqa2dca
transaction
3ac3f4fcb556459462a781b902cea23dcc29afa7ef6a94cc6a9a3b53aba6dbd6